My iWeb site http://web.mac.com/longhorn89/iWeb/Site/Library.html no longer works on either my home or work computers. OSX 10.4.11. iWeb 1.1.2. MobileMe is active. Please advise. Thanks in advance.

When did you notice that the site couldn't be found?  When was the last time you updated the site?  If it's been a while, several months the .mac sites have been changed to .me sites and the sites are being published to your iDisk/Web/Sites folder.  Files in other folders on the iDisk are no longer reachable online.
Try this:
go to the System/MobileMe preference pane and log out of MMe.
login with a bogus username and password like "test" and "test". This clears the caches.
login with your correct username and password, launch iWeb and try again.
republish your site in full.
then try this URL to get to your site: http://web.me.com/longhorn89/
See if you can find your site now.

  • I can no longer publish my ICal work calendar

    Just updated to the new calendar in mobile me but it deleted all previous calendars that were on my iCal app on desktop computer.  Fixed that with apple's help, but can no longer publish new calendar updates that are created on home desk top computer/ical (not mobile me).  The radio beacon is no longer present on the work calendar that has been published for 5 years and in the tool bar under Calendar "published" is not able to be selected.  I have 81 mb of my iDisk being used and over 9 gb of free space.  Any help/ideas out there.  Thank you.

    This is odd: I have no trouble doing this. However I'm on Snow Leopard, so I don't know what difference Leopard makes.
    When Apple sorted out your initial problem with the calendars after the upgrade, are you sure they didn't land you with MobileMe calendars? The new calendars live on MobileMe and Leopard can read them and display them in your iCal - I don't know whether it lists them under your MobileMe login name as Snow Leopard does.
    Try this: create a new calendar and make sure that it's 'On My Mac'. Add a single event to it just so that there is something there. Can you publish this? If so, then the other calendars probably are on MobileMe and need to be transferred back to your Mac (from where they won't sync with MobileMe).
    This is the procedure for shifting calendars back to 'On My Mac':
    Select a calendar listed under your MobileMe login name.
    From the File menu choose Export...>Export. An .ics file will be saved at your designated destination.
    Create a new calendar with the same name as the one you've just exported from, choosing 'On My Mac'.
    From the File menu choose Import... Select the .ics file and choose to import it into the calendar you just created (make sure you don't import it into the MobileMe version).
    When complete, check that it's OK and then you can delete the MobileMe version.
    Repeat for other calendars. I should keep the .ics files for a bit as a safety until you are quite sure everything is correct.

    The A in this website does not show up in iweb only after publishing, how do I take it out?

    Roger Wilmut1 wrote:
    If the server was sending UTF-8 what would this character appear as?
    You can see this for yourself by going to View > Text Encoding in your browser and setting it to UTF-8.  The characters will disappear.  They normally represent non-break spaces.   When the page is sent (or read) in Latin-1 encoding instead of UTF-8, they appear as Latin characters instead of empty space.
    The different results of PageSpinner are probably because it is using some other encoding like MacRoman.

  • Downloaded Lion and Now iWeb Won't Publish New Page or Changes?

    Hello,
    I am having the hardest time getting iWeb now publish info. After updating to Lion iWeb will not publish anything new I do on iWeb. It will act like it is publishing everything but nothing shows up on the net. What do I need to do to fix this?

    Try the following:
    delete the iWeb preference files, com.apple.iWeb.plist and com.apple.iWeb.plist.lockfile, that resides in your Home() /Library/Preferences folder.
    go to your Home()/Library/Caches/com.apple.iWeb folder and delete its contents.
    Click to view full size
    launch iWeb and try again.
    The following will assist you in using iWeb with Lion partidularly if you have more than one domain file:
    In Lion the Library folder is now invisible. To make it permanently visible enter the following in the Terminal application window: chflags nohidden ~/Library and hit the Enter button - 10.7: Un-hide the User Library folder.
    To open your domain file in Lion or to switch between multiple domain files Cyclosaurus has provided us with the following script that you can make into an Applescript application with Script Editor. Open Script Editor, copy and paste the script below into Script Editor's window and save as an application.
    do shell script "/usr/bin/defaults write com.apple.iWeb iWebDefaultsDocumentPath -boolean no"delay 1
    tell application "iWeb" to activate
    You can download an already compiled version with this link: iWeb Switch Domain.
    Just launch the application, find and select the domain file you want to open and it will open with iWeb. It modifies the iWeb preference file each time it's launched so one can switch between domain files.
    WARNING: iWeb Switch Domain will overwrite an existing Domain.sites2 file if you select to create a new domain in the same folder.  So rename your domain files once they've been created to something other than the default name.

  • IWeb Quits when Publishing - Apple Genius said to Archive & Reinstall

    Just spent over an hour with an Apple Genius at the Apple store to see if he could alleviate my problem with iWeb quitting whenever I tried to publish. I've been using iWeb for the last 5 months and have successfully posted hundreds of blog posts and pictures to my site on a .Mac account - but in the last 24 hours, I've been unable to get new posts published because iweb has been crashing prior to finishing the publish request.
    I've tried deleting the iWeb preferences in /myname/library/prefernces as well as clearing my cache files and plain old rebooting. Also tried reinstalling the 1.1. update. The Genius reinstalled iWeb at the store and then I updated. Nothing's been fixed. I still crash when I publish. The only possible solution (according to the Genius) is to bite the bullet and do an Archive and Install. Anyone had luck with this?
    Macbook Pro   Mac OS X (10.4.6)  

    I would go with a second User account first, as suggested by James.
    If this doesn't work, I would be thinking corrupt prefs files within the domain file itself....
    1. Quit iWeb
    2. Navigate to the domain file, User/Library/Application Support/iWeb/domain
    3. CREATE A COPY OF THIS FILE, and then move it to somewhere safe.
    4. Now back to the original, "control+click" (Right click if you have one of those new fangled two button mice (mouses?!?) )
    5. From the pop-up menu, choose "Show Package Contents"
    6. Sort the finder window by "Kind", it brings all of the plist files inside iWeb together.
    assets.YourUserName.plist - This one is a regular problem!
    ServerCachedResources.plist
    sharedassets.plist
    deletedComments.YourUserName.plist
    I have deleted all of these when having different problems, not specifically iWeb quittting when publishing, I dont think that that has happened to me.
    I do have a tendancy to lose blog comments, perhaps deleting these files has caused it.
    I also know that once I have deleted them and relaunched iWeb, done a Publish All to .Mac, all of my problems have gone.
    The plist files are all recreated the first time you do this.
    You may or may not want to try this, but on a copy of your domain.sites file is there anything to lose? Other than your sanity?
    You might want to do one at a time or all at once.
